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Atteindre les cellules à partir d'une liste de validation

L

luc

Guest
Bonsoir,


J'ai créer une liste de validation sur une plage horizontale J2:CI2

Question : à partir de cette source, est-il possible d'atteindre directement une cellule à partir de la valeur selectionnée dans la liste.

Je vous remercie par avance de vos réponses et je réitère mes meilleurs voeux à l'ensemble du forum.

Luc
 
H

Hervé

Guest
Bonjour

Si j'ai bien compris, un code à mettre dans la feuille adéquate (clique droit sur l'onglet et visualiser le code)

En imaginant que ta liste de validation se trouve en A1 par exemple, et que tes données sont sur la meme feuille.

De plus il ne faut pas que ta liste comporte de doublons.

Private Sub Worksheet_Change(ByVal Target As Range)
Dim c As Range

If Not Application.Intersect(Target, Range("A1")) Is Nothing Then
For Each c In Range("J2:CI2 ")
If c.Value = Target.Value Then
c.Select
End If
Next c
End If

End Sub

permet moi de te souhaiter une bonne année 2005.

Salut
Hervé
 

Discussions similaires

Réponses
8
Affichages
657
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…